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Hendon to Burnley Central start from as little as £43.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Hendon to Burnley Central start from £85.40 one way, or £122.00 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Hendon to Burnley Central are available for £189.80 one way, or £379.60 return

Facilities and Amenities

Hendon Station is equipped with facilities designed to make your journey smooth and convenient. Ticket purchasing and collection options include a ticket office available from Monday to Saturday, along with accessible ticket machines. Smartcard services like issuance and validation are supported, simplifying the travel experience for commuters.

Accessibility at Hendon is partial, with step-free access available from the car park to platform 1, suitable for those traveling towards London. It is important to note that other platforms require steps. For travelers requiring assistance, the station offers staff help during ticket office opening hours, and there's a mobile assistance team on call should you need it. The station also houses a customer help point to facilitate your journey, though it lacks certain amenities such as luggage storage and waiting lounges.

While basic seating is provided, the station does not have heated waiting rooms or refreshment facilities. There are 43 car parking spaces available, with the added benefit of 5 accessible spots. Bicycle storage is ample, offering 64 spaces in sheltered racks. For security, CCTV is installed across the station.

Facilities and Services

The station hosts a ticket office that operates from Monday to Friday between 06:30 and 13:30, ensuring a smooth start to your journey. If you're purchasing your tickets through machines, worry not—they're accessible and equipped with induction loops for hearing aid users. While Burnley Central issues smartcards, be warned there aren’t any smartcard validators on-site.

For those with specific mobility needs, Burnley Central offers step-free access throughout the station. It's worth noting that there are no tactile paving areas, but the station is navigable for mobility scooters. Facilities include seating areas, although there are no waiting rooms, toilets, or baby changing amenities. CCTV is present to enhance passenger safety, while the nearby car park, managed by Northern, offers 50 spaces with modest parking rates, accessible details available via the RingGo website.

Onward Transport Connections

Burnley Central ensures you stay connected even after your train ride. The bus station isn’t far off, with local services accessible via Busline by calling 0871 200 2233. For taxi services, Northern Railway provides options through their Cab4You service, perfect for reaching destinations slightly off the beaten track.

If cycling is your preference, note that you can park your bike by using the sheltered stands situated off Railway Street, though bicycle hire is not directly available at the station. In case of rail disruptions, the rail replacement service is located at Curzon St adjacent to the Railway Bridge, ensuring your travel plans are less impacted.
